Gemsbok and calf at sunset

A Gemsbok with its calf on the dunes in the Walvis Bay region. Incorrectly called an Oryx. Oryx is the name of a genus that consists of 4 large species of antelopes. Scimitar oryx, Gemsbok, East African oryx, and the Arabian oryx.

This image was captured on the only guided safari we took on our trip. Our host/guide J.P. was truly fabulous and got us to some of the exceptional areas in these expansive dunes.
